Archaeology Notes

NS97SE 82 9592 7173.

A large brick and tile works consisting of three long drying sheds and two large kilns. A 10 h.p. steam engine is used in the manufacture. The clay pits lie to the west (one is shown at NS 9670 7187) and the clay is conveyed to the sheds by a small iron tramway. About sixteen hands male and female, constantly employed. The property is feued by John Alexander from W Gillon of Wallhouse.

OS 6" map, 1st ed, 1854; Name Book 1854

Nothing shown.

OS 6" map, 1898.
